We are seeking a senior AI Engineer with demonstrative experience building and shipping AI agents in production applications to join our team. At NewtonX, we’re developing an innovative AI-powered quantitative analysis platform that transforms raw survey data into actionable business insights, dramatically accelerating our clients decision-making processes.


Responsibilities

  • Design and develop scalable and production-grade agents using LangGraph, tool calling, prompt engineering, and other various techniques for producing high-quality output from our agentic systems using the Python programming language. 

  • Contribute to test coverage of all agentic processes and outputs including unit, integration, e2e tests, and LangSmith datasets and experiments. 

  • Research, experiment with, and maintain deep understanding of latest technologies in the generative AI space including new models, capabilities, and techniques for developing AI-powered applications in order to take advantage of new developments in this ever-changing field. 

  • Collaborate cross-functionally with engineers, data analysts, product managers, designers, and business stakeholders to define, design, and deliver innovative AI-driven solutions that meet our customer’s needs.

  • Mentor and support more junior engineers as it relates to AI initiatives.

Required

  • 5 years minimum experience as a software engineer with at least 1 of experience developing LLM-powered systems using the LangChain framework including LangGraph, and tool calling.

  • Demonstrative experience using LangSmith to evaluate and improve agent performance.

  • Deep technical understanding of the Python programming language and experience deploying production applications using it. 

  • Experience developing applications leveraging streaming.

  • Experience working on Agile/Scrum teams.

  • Develops all code with unit and integration tests using frameworks like Pytest, UnitTest, etc.

  • Strong understanding and experience with using git for version control. 

  • Bachelors degree or greater.

Bonus Skills

  • Experience working with and deploying applications on the Google Cloud Platform (GCP)

  • Hands-on experience developing web applications, including REST APIs and modern web frameworks such as Django, FastApi, etc.

  • Experience working with various data stores such as relational databases (Postgres), graph databases (Neo4j), and vector stores.
